基于SystemViewHDB3编码仿真系统.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
基于SystemViewHDB3编码仿真系统

基于SystemViewHDB3编码仿真系统   [摘 要] HDB3码是一种应用广泛的线路传输码。文章借助SystemView软件,以一个完整的HDB3码的编码系统为例,详细地描述了SystemView 通信系统仿真的过程以及仿真的结果分析。   [关键词] SystemView HDB3码编码 仿真实验   一、概述   80年代以来,通信和信号处理系统越来越复杂,各种新技术的发展对通信系统的实现起着重大的影响。通信系统复杂性的增加使得分析与设计所需的时间和费用也迅速上升,为了节约人力、物力、财力和时间,就需要进行系统仿真。本文结合CNI系统中的一些具体技术利用仿真专用工具对其进行系统仿真。SystemView是一个信号级的系统仿真软件。它不但使设计人员能够设计、开发和测试子系统,而且能全面地从头到尾集成系统。直观而有力的SystemView能够提供模拟、数字、混合模式系统的开发;线性和非线性系统设计;Laplace 和Z变换线性系统等,其用户界面使这些特点非常容易理解,用于通信、逻辑、DSP和射频/模拟设计的大量可供选择的库能够使工程设计人员灵活选择使用。   二、HDB3码编码原理   NRZ码用高电平和低电平(常为0电平)分别表示二进制信息1和 0,在每个码元期间电平保持不变。其功率谱中含有丰富的低频分量乃至直流分量,产生的码间干扰大,当出现长串的连续1或0时会造成时钟提取困难。一般情况下,可作为近距离信息传输的基带码型或载波传输时的数字调制信号码型。   HDB3码是在AM I (A lternative Mark Inverzsion)码基础上改进的一种半占空比的归零码,抑制了长串连1和连0现象,具有无直流分量、抗干扰能力强、有利于时钟提取等优点,广泛应用于长距离数字通信的PCM系统中。   NRZ 码到HDB3码的变换规则:当NRZ 码序列中连0个数小于4时,按AM I码编码规则处理,即用B+和B-交替表示信息1,用0表示信息0;当NRZ码序列中连0个数超过3个时,则以4连0码为一组,第4个0用V符号(称为破坏点)代替,相邻V脉冲的极性要交替变化,若相邻V脉冲间的B脉冲的个数为偶数时,需将4连0码中的第一个0用B脉冲代替,其极性与前一个B脉冲相反,同时后面的B脉冲极性交替变化。即出现4连0码时,其取代节有四种:000V +、000V - 、B+ 00V +、B- 00V - ,具体取代节的选取由上述规则决定。   下面以信息序列110110000001000000001为例来说明HDB3码的具体编码方法。(1)用特殊序列代替连0组:11011B00V001000VB00V1,(2):标上极性得HDB3码-1+10-1+1-B00-V00+1000+V-B00-V+1   三、HDB3码编码器的SystemView仿真实验系统   根据前述原理,利用仿真系SystemView统构建的HDB3码编码器如图1所示。为便于观察,仿真时设置二进制信息速率为10bps。                              随机产生的输入二进制单极性信息序列及仿真编码器输出的相应 HDB3码波形如图2所示。                              其中二进制信息序列及仿真编码器输出的HDB3码分别为:信息:11010110010111100011100100000010100110011100110110000100010001010000111 11000010000111110101000101010101   HDB3码:-1+10-10+1-100+10-1+1-1+1000-1+1-100+1-B00-V00+10-100+1-100+1-1+1 00-1+10-1+1000+V-1000+1000-10+1-B00-V+1-1+1-1+1000+V-1000-V+1-1+1-1+10-10+1000-10+10-10+10-1   可见,仿真输出的HDB3码符合其编码规则。运用SystemView分析窗中的计算器对输出HDB3码进行了频谱分析,得到幅度谱。为便于比较,同时给出相同速率的双极性码的幅度谱。两种码型的频谱如图3所示。                              图3 HDB3码与双极码频谱比较   从上面的仿真过程及仿真结果,得到如下结论:   (1)编码器电路设计正确,设计思想适合于硬件和软件实现;   (2)从HDB3码波形图可见,HDB3码中无长连0,便于接收端获取位定时信号;   (3)从HDB3码频谱可见,HDB3码无直流,低频分量也很小,功率集中在码元速率值

文档评论(0)

189****7685 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档